Join Melina Meza and Jenny Hayo for an exploration of yoga, meditation, and nutrition on the tropical island of Hawaii. This retreat, led by two senior 8 Limbs Yoga Centers (Seattle) instructors, will be a wonderful way to deeply immerse yourself in your practice of yoga and mindfulness. With their passionate enthusiasm for yoga and their thoughtful and uplifting approach to teaching, Melina and Jenny will lead you through a 7-day journey filled with inspiration, humor, and delight.
Melina will guide you through Vinyasa flow practices and nutrition lectures designed to strengthen your daily commitment to healthy living. Jenny’s teachings will offer alignment, pranayama, and meditation tools to cultivate steadiness, grace, and confidence.
About the Facilitator(s)
Melina has been teaching yoga full-time since 1997. Throughout the year, she leads national and international retreats and workshops that blend her two areas of passion and expertise--yoga and nutrition. Melina is the author of The Art of Sequencing, the first in a series of yoga and wellness tools, and is currently working on her second book. For more information visit: www.melinameza.com.
Jenny Hayo has been studying yoga since 1996. Her teachings are rooted in Patanjali's 8 Limbs of Yoga and include inspiration from many teachers including Tias Little, Jo Leffingwell, and Sarah Powers. Jenny teaches weekly asana and classes, workshops, and retreats and is a member of the 8 Limbs Yoga Center's Teacher Trainer faculty.
